BJP Alleges Pawar Has Links With Balwa

BeyondHeadlines Staff Reporter

Mumbai: Eknath Khadse,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) legislator and the leader of opposition in the Maharashtra Assembly, has said that Sharad Pawar, chief of the Nationalist Congress Party (NCP) and union agriculture minister, has close connections with 2G spectrum scam accused Shahid Usman Balwa.

Khadse claimed in the Maharashtra Assembly on March 31 that Pawar had travelled with Balwa to Dubai twice in Balwa’s plane. Khadse also alleged that Shashank Manohar, president of the Board of Control for Cricket in India, was also in the plane. According to Khasde, another NCP leader and Union Minister of Heavy Industries and Public Enterprises, Praful Patel, also used Balwa’s plane in the past.

The BJP MLA claimed that he had all the evidences and demanded an inquiry.

There was uproar in the Maharashtra assembly on Thursday after Khadse made a sensational claim that NCP chief Sharad Pawar had travelled in a plane owned by Shahid Balwa, key accused in the 2G scam.

He claimed that on February 8, 2010 Sharad Pawar along with Balwa, Shashank Manohar, former ICC president Haroon Lorgat and Vinod Goenka flew to Dubai on a plane belonging to Shahid Balwa’s company Eon aviation.

He said Sharad Pawar took an Eon aviation flight on another instance also though that time Balwa was not with him.

Khadse also claimed that on April 10, 2010 Praful Patel travelled with Balwa and Vinod Goenka to Bangalore.

On seven other occasions, Praful Patel took an Eon aviation flight to various domestic locations.

Khadse also claims state minister and NCP leader Jayant Patil too used an eon aviation flight on two occasions.

Khadse has demanded an inquiry into Pawar’s links with Balwa though Pawar had earlier denied links with the man arrested in the 2G spectrum scam case.

“If Pawar has no links with Balwa then why did he travel to Bangalore with Balwa and Praful Patel,” said Khadse.

NCP MLA Jitendra Avhad though has defended his party chief stating that even the BJP’s Nitin Gadkari and Shiv Sena Execuitve President Uddhav Thackeray too used Eon aviation flights.

“The same plane was used by BJP president Nitin Gadkari and Uddhav Thackeray. What does Khadse have to say regarding that,” said Avhad.

The Opposition has demanded a reply from the state government in the house and home minister RR Patil is expected to respond.
